Elaine Kao is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Immunology and Cancer Research. According to data from OpenAlex, Elaine Kao has authored 8 papers receiving a total of 561 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Immunology and 2 papers in Cancer Research. Recurrent topics in Elaine Kao’s work include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(2 papers) and R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(2 papers). Elaine Kao is often cited by papers focused on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(2 papers) and R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(2 papers). Elaine Kao collaborates with scholars based in United States and Denmark. Elaine Kao's co-authors include Michael David, Xia Gao, Manqing Li, Sébastien Landry, Mariana Pavon-Eternod, Tao Pan, Matthew D. Weitzman, Hilary Sandig, Thomas Jones and Robert C. Rickert and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, The Journal of Experimental Medicine and Blood.
